The Chapel was finished in 1905 and was in use until 2007 when the 3 Catholic Parishes (St. Michael’s, St. Patrick’s, and St. Peter’s) merged into one. The new Parish is now known as St. Katharine Drexel Parish. In November 2010 we purchased the church from St. Katharine Drexel Parish. A lifeless shell that had been empty for 3 years, we hope to revitalize this stately building, share its beauty and grandeur with the community, and open it to all who are looking for a unique space to hold events. Opening in mid-summer of 2011, Chapel of the Archangels is limited only by your imagination, we offer a great place to hold weddings, wedding receptions, anniversaries, vow renewals. The sky’s the limit! We also offer a convenient reception hall, meeting and educational facility in the Angel’s Den downstairs, complete with bar, kitchen facilities, and Wi-Fi. We are a non-denominational facility. We are also handicapped accessible to both the main sanctuary and to the basement via the elevator.

How Much Do Wisconsin Wedding Venues Cost?

Wedding venues across Wisconsin typically cost between $1,500 and $15,000+ which aligns perfectly with the national average of $6,500-$12,000. Your total budget will depend largely on how many guests you invite. For 50 guests you're looking at about $18,004 while 100 guests jumps to around $30,000. With 150 guests expect to spend approximately $41,280 and 200 guests increases to $51,366. Larger weddings with 250 guests run about $61,453 and 300 guests reaches $71,540. The venue itself represents only about 16% of your total budget averaging $6,625 for a 150-guest wedding which means you're getting excellent value for your investment.

How Can You Maximize Your Wisconsin Venue Budget?

Cost CategoryAverage CostPercentage of Total
Venue$6,62516%
Catering$5,30013%
Flowers$5,33313%
Photography$4,33711%
Bar Services$4,24010%
Videography$3,4988%

September ranks as Wisconsin's most popular wedding month but you'll find substantial discounts if you book between November and April. Friday weddings typically save you 10-15% compared to Saturday events which can free up thousands for other aspects of your celebration. Many venues offer package deals that combine services for added value especially during off-peak seasons.
